Are there any 18.4" quality screens?
I own a Clevo P180HM and I hate the stock screen with every fiber of my being. The slightest tilt induces a colour shift. It has some serious spill issues. Vertical viewing angles suck. Overall, the screen really sucks. I have a 299 € eMachines that has a less crappy screen!
I don't mind spending money for a quality panel, but the problem is that there aren't a lot of 18.4" panels out there.
Non TN panels would be ideal, but I'll settle for anything with decent vertical angles and fairly even backlighting, even if it's TN.
Any recommendations? Thanks

Re: Are there any 18.4" quality screens?
Are you refering to the famous Samsung LTN184HT02 (RGB LED)-112% Color Gamut/ 1000:1 Contrast Ratio panel that equiped the those Sony laptops?
Saddly it seems it has been discontinued, according to this thread: The myth about 90% color gamut of samsung 1080p 18.4 laptop display
The LTN184HT01 is CCFL, so it is not an alternative.
That being said, are 18.4" owners stuck with chi mei panels?
It saddens me that 18.4" laptops are a dying breed.
